About Standard Optionfx

Standard Optionfx (website standardoptionpip.com) is not regulated by any recognized financial authority. No registration or license could be verified with the Malta Financial Services Authority (MFSA), Companies House in the United Kingdom, the UK Financial Conduct Authority (FCA), the US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C), or the National Futures Association (NFA) (). The domain appears to be non-functional, and regulatory indexes indicate zero oversight, suggesting extremely high risk ().

The company lists an address at 52 Vanderbilt Ave, New York, NY 10017, United States, but this does not correspond to any verified regulatory registration. The site's operations lack evidence of segregation of client funds, transparent regulation, or account protections ().
